Test your limits in ITTA, a bullet-hell, boss-rush style adventure. Armed with her father’s revolver and guided by a strange ghostly cat, a displaced girl must battle her way through impossible trials in search of answers… and peace.

ITTA is a indie, action and bullet hell game developed by Glass Revolver and published by Armor Games Studios.
Released on April 22nd 2020 is available only on Windows in 8 languages: English, Japanese, French, German, Spanish - Spain, Portuguese - Brazil, Russian and Simplified Chinese.

It has received 368 reviews of which 332 were positive and 36 were negative resulting in a rating of 8.3 out of 10. 😎

System requirements

These are the minimum specifications needed to play the game. For the best experience, we recommend that you verify them.

Windows
  • OS *: Windows 7 or newer
  • Processor: Intel Core 2 Duo or AMD Equivalent
  • Memory: 2 GB RAM
  • Graphics: GeForce 9600 GT / Radeon HD 5770
  • Storage: 300 MB available space

I don't know if I can say it's worth fifteen dollars, it's a fairly short game for what it is; the first time you play it, everything's hard and it's easy to get lost + the boss fight bullet patterns are hard. You do a second playthrough (like for the no death achievement) and suddenly knowing where all the extra health and weapons are hidden makes it really easy. The hardest bosses are the earliest ones. I wouldn't say that you should damage sponge the bosses, but the moment you get a good weapon (the sword) you are fine. My second run was my No Death Run. The achievements are mostly fine, but for a lot of them are permanently missable because of the game's structure. It's fine because subsequent playthroughs aren't long (bosses are fun but they aren't long, most of the game is wandering around trying to find secrets or trying to get extra health before going to a boss.) That being said, I got this on sale for like two dollars and it was definitely a fun time. I do think it's worth more than 2 dollars just not worth 15, so if it's on sale it's a good price.
